Katherine O'Regan - Outside Politics

Outside Politics

O'Regan is a former council member of Family Planning New Zealand. She favours compulsory sex education from age ten and condom vending machines in all secondary schools and public toilets.

She has been the chair of the Te Awamutu Community Public Relations Organisation.

She has been Chair of the Human Ethics in Research Committee for eight years at Waikato Institute of Technology and is currently serving on the NZ Law Society Waikato/Bay of Plenty Complaints Committee.
